  • Wake Up Sleepy Bear

    Shaw Chritine Morton, Greg Shaw, John Butler

    Paperback (Puffin, Jan. 2, 2007)
    This is a gentle, rhyming story, full of beautiful baby animals and perfect for bedtime. One by one, all the animals in the forest wake up to find something very special has happened - they don't know what it is yet but they know it's very special. They each gather a gift and form a procession to find out what it is. Finally they reach a clearing and there they meet a beautiful, shy and wonderful newborn baby fawn.

  • Sleep, Black Bear, Sleep

    Jane Yolen, Heidi E.y. Stemple, Brooke Dyer

    Library Binding (HarperCollins, Feb. 1, 2007)
    When winter's snow creates a soft blanket of silence, nothing is more comforting than curling up under a cozy quilt. Whether slumber awaits in a warm bed, a rocking hammock, or a nest of leaves, the feeling of comfort and the infinite world of dreams are universal. This reassuring lullaby will calm any child to sleep, while Brooke Dyer's gentle illustrations show that the little details in everyone's niche truly make a place into a home.

  • Sleepy Bear

    Satoshi Iriyama

    Board book (Gakken, Sept. 1, 2020)
    The perfect naptime and bedtime story to help little ones drift off to sleep told by best-selling, internationally beloved author and illustrator.Join fuzzy, cuddly Sleepy Bear as he searches for a sweet spot to nap in after eating a big meal. Find a special gatefold surprises and peek-through pages inside! After a delicious feast, Sleepy Bear searches for the perfect nap spot. Will it be the hole in the tree? On top of the bumpy bridge? Or in this hollow log? In every place Sleepy Bear searches, he meets a new friend. But, will Sleepy Bear find the perfect spot for a nap? The best bedtime story for babies and toddlers! - This book is the perfect companion for nap time and features sweet, soft illustrations and a sleepy character that children will relate to. - Ideal for the Thanksgiving holiday, Sleepy Bear celebrates feasts and friends and the longing to sleep after a big meal. - Sleepy Bear creates a beautiful bonding experience between a sleepy child and the person reading the story. Gakken Publishing is the largest publisher of children's educational books in Japan. For the first time, these sophisticated and exciting books are now available to parents, teachers, and caregivers in the United States.
